Tip 1: Prep Your Skin and Your Schedule for Waxing Comfort
What you do in the days leading up to a wax can dramatically influence the session’s comfort level.
A thoughtful prep routine helps the skin respond more smoothly to waxing and minimizes post-wax sensitivity.
This is not only about hair removal; it’s about creating a calm foundation for your body to feel cared for.
What to do before you arrive
1) Gentle exfoliation 24–48 hours before your appointment supports a uniform wax and reduces ingrown hairs.
Use a mild body scrub or a soft washcloth to remove dull, dry skin without over-scrubbing.
This exfoliation step is a simple way to keep skin resilient and ready for a smoother session.
2) Hydration matters.
Hydrated skin responds better to wax, and well-hydrated skin often means less pulling sensation.
Drink water and apply a light, plant-based moisturizer to non-waxed areas if your skin tends toward dryness.
3) Avoid irritants that can inflame skin, such as aggressive exfoliants, strong acids, or new skincare products that might cause reaction.
If you’re using active ingredients, share this with your esthetician beforehand so we can adjust the approach for your skin type and comfort.
What to wear and bring
1) Wear loose, breathable clothing to minimize friction after the wax.
A soft cotton or jersey fabric helps prevent rubbing that can irritate freshly waxed skin.
2) Bring a light, fragrance-free moisturizer or soothing balm approved by your esthetician.
In our space, we often recommend a gentle botanical product that supports calm skin without clogging pores.
3) Consider timing that reduces heat or physical activity right after the appointment.
Scheduling your wax for a time when you can unwind—perhaps a post-session facial or a calm rest moment—can enhance the overall experience.

Tip 2: Choose the Right Wax and Technique for Your Skin’s Comfort
Technique and product choice play pivotal roles in Waxing Comfort.
The right wax formulation, combined with skilled application, can significantly reduce pull, minimize irritation, and deliver smoother results.
This is where the experience and training of a trusted spa team matter, especially when skin types vary from one person to the next.
Understanding wax options
1) Soft wax versus hard wax: Soft wax is common for larger areas; hard wax is often preferred for delicate or sensitive zones.
The best choice depends on your skin’s sensitivity, hair texture, and the esthetician’s approach.
Our team uses tailored techniques and ensures the correct wax type for each client, prioritizing calm skin and steady pressure.
2) Temperature and patch testing: A consistent, appropriate temperature reduces the feeling of heat or sting.
A quick patch test helps anticipate reactions and keeps the session smooth from the start.
3) Post-wax skin care during the session: Our estheticians apply soothing products that support the skin’s barrier, minimize redness, and create a comfortable environment for continued relaxation.

Tip 4: On-The-Day Protocols: How to Stay Calm and Present During Your Wax
Day-of routines can either amplify nervousness or reinforce tranquility.
By following simple, practical steps, you keep your nervous system calm and your skin ready for a smooth, efficient session.
This is where a trusted spa partner makes a real difference in your waxing journey.
Breathing and presence
1) Begin with a few deep breaths to reset before the appointment begins.
Slow inhales through the nose, a short pause, and long exhales through the mouth can reset tension in the shoulders and jaw.
2) Grounding: Focus on contact with the table or chair and the sensation of your hands resting on the fabric.
A gentle body scan helps you release tension in the lower back and legs, supporting overall comfort.
3) Communication: Share any particular sensitivities or areas to avoid.
A quick note about skin that tenses easily or a prior wax experience that felt less comfortable helps your esthetician tailor the approach in real time.
Physical considerations on the day of waxing
1) Avoid heavy workouts right before waxing if you know you’ll be sensitive afterward.
Light movement can help, but intense sweating can irritate freshly waxed skin.
2) Skip heavy lotions or oils on the day of the wax, unless advised by your esthetician.
A clean canvas can lead to a cleaner wax and less residual product on the skin.
3) Bring a small bottle of water and a light snack if you’re prone to dizziness or low energy during longer sessions.
Maintaining blood sugar stability helps the body stay calm and focused.

Tip 5: Post-Wax Recovery That Extends Comfort and Confidence
Recovery is when you translate a successful waxing session into lasting wellness gains.
Thoughtful post-wax care reduces redness, swelling, and irritation, helping you resume daily activities with ease and a positive mood.
The post-care routine is an essential part of Waxing Comfort that clients often overlook until they experience the difference.
Immediate aftercare steps
1) Apply a soothing, fragrance-free balm or gel to the waxed area.
The aim is to calm the skin, restore moisture, and shield against friction from clothing.
2) Avoid heat exposure for at least 24 hours.
This means hot showers, saunas, steam rooms, and hot tubs should be limited.
A cool, comfortable environment supports skin recovery.
3) Wear breathable fabrics and loose clothing for the next day or two.
Natural fibers like cotton reduce rubbing and help the skin recover without irritation.
Longer-term care strategies
1) Hydration and gentle skincare: Maintain hydration and offer the skin light, nourishing emollients to support barrier function.
A plant-based moisturizer with soothing botanical extracts can make a meaningful difference.
2) Gentle exfoliation after the initial recovery window can help prevent ingrown hairs.
Your esthetician will guide you on timing and technique to avoid irritation while promoting skin renewal.
3) Sun protection: If the waxed area is exposed to the sun, use a broad-spectrum sunscreen to prevent hyperpigmentation and protect delicate skin.
